Film, television, music – and fashion: Designers now a mainstay of showbiz

The Captivating Intersection of Fashion and Entertainment: A Cinematic Odyssey

The entertainment industry has long been a stage for fashion's grandest displays, with red carpet events serving as the ultimate showcase. However, the relationship between these two realms has evolved, transcending the fleeting moments of awards season. From the silver screen to the concert stage, fashion has become an integral part of the storytelling process, shaping the visual narratives that captivate audiences worldwide.

Elevating the Art of Cinematic Couture

Designers Stepping into the Spotlight

The film industry has increasingly turned to renowned fashion designers to elevate the visual aesthetics of their productions. In the case of the highly anticipated film "Challengers," director Luca Guadagnino tapped the creative genius of Jonathan Anderson, the mastermind behind the celebrated labels JW Anderson and Loewe. Anderson's involvement in crafting the film's costumes speaks volumes about the growing importance of fashion in the cinematic realm.Guadagnino's penchant for collaborating with fashion luminaries is not a new phenomenon. In his previous films, such as "I Am Love" and "A Bigger Splash," he has worked with the acclaimed designer Raf Simons. This trend extends beyond the silver screen, as Guadagnino has also directed short films for luxury brands like Zegna, Dior, Fendi, and Jil Sander, further blurring the lines between fashion and filmmaking.

Barbie's Couture Transformation

The recent hit film "Barbie" showcases another remarkable fashion-film collaboration. Chanel, the iconic fashion house, officially partnered with the production, providing costume designer Jacqueline Durran with a selection of outfits from various collections. These carefully curated ensembles were chosen to "highlight the Barbie character as she moves through her journey in the film," according to a statement from Chanel.This collaboration underscores the growing recognition of fashion's ability to enhance the visual storytelling of films. By integrating renowned brands and designers, filmmakers can elevate the cinematic experience, creating a seamless fusion of style and narrative.

Dune's Runway-Worthy Couture

The highly anticipated sequel to "Dune" further exemplifies the intertwining of fashion and film. The red carpet premieres of the film were akin to runway shows, with lead actress Zendaya donning breathtaking archival designs from prestigious labels like Thierry Mugler, Givenchy, Stephane Rolland, JuunJ, Roksanda, Louis Vuitton, Alaia, Bottega Veneta, and Torisheju Dumi.Zendaya's co-stars, including Florence Pugh and Timothee Chalamet, also showcased stunning looks from major fashion brands, which the film proudly highlighted and shared on social media. This level of fashion extravagance, typically reserved for high-profile awards ceremonies, has now become an integral part of the cinematic experience, captivating audiences and fashion enthusiasts alike.

Designers Take Center Stage

The growing intersection of fashion and entertainment is not limited to the silver screen. This year has witnessed a surge of films and television series that delve into the lives and legacies of renowned fashion designers.The biographical drama miniseries "Cristobal Balenciaga" premiered in January, shining a spotlight on the life and impact of the Guetaria-born designer. In February, the series "The New Look" explored the lives of fashion icons Christian Dior and Coco Chanel during the World War II Nazi occupation of Paris and its aftermath.Most recently, "Becoming Karl Lagerfeld" and "Diane Von Furstenberg: Woman In Charge" have further explored the meteoric rise of these legendary designers, showcasing their unique contributions to the fashion industry.

Fashion Takes the Stage

The influence of fashion extends beyond the silver screen, permeating the world of live performances as well. In 2022, fashion houses bowed down to the undisputed "Queen Bey," Beyoncé, as she graced the stage for her Renaissance World Tour. The custom-made outfits she wore were designed to showcase her distinct style, blending high fashion with her captivating stage presence.Similarly, Taylor Swift's Eras Tour saw the integration of bespoke outfits for each segment, reflecting the evolution of her musical journey. For both Beyoncé and Swift, the collaboration with fashion designers goes beyond mere wardrobe selection; it involves the creation of unique designs tailored to the artists' specific needs and creative visions.

Fashion's Foray into Entertainment

The growing synergy between fashion and entertainment has not gone unnoticed by industry leaders. In a testament to this trend, LVMH, the luxury conglomerate, has launched an entertainment division called 22 Montaigne Entertainment. This division aims to explore opportunities for LVMH's prestigious brands, including Dior, Tiffany & Co., and Louis Vuitton, to further integrate with the world of entertainment.As LVMH CEO Anish Melwani stated, "Culture and entertainment are inextricably linked, and LVMH has been building culture for decades." This strategic move underscores the recognition that fashion and entertainment are no longer separate realms, but rather intertwined spheres that can mutually benefit from each other's influence and reach.The appointment of singer-songwriter Pharrell Williams as the menswear head of Louis Vuitton further exemplifies the blurring of boundaries between fashion and showbiz. This convergence of talent and expertise is a testament to the transformative power of this dynamic relationship.
